#92F269 Color Information
Hex color code: #92F269
The hex color #92F269 is a vivid green with RGB values of (146, 242, 105) and HSL of (102°, 84%, 68%). It is commonly used in modern UI design.

RGB, HSL and CMYK Values
RGB
146, 242, 105
Red: 146 / Green: 242 / Blue: 105
HSL
102°, 84%, 68%
Hue: 102° / Saturation: 84% / Lightness: 68%
CMYK
40%, 0%, 57%, 5%
Cyan: 40% / Magenta: 0% / Yellow: 57% / Key: 5%

Color Meaning and Usage
#92F269 is a bold green color with RGB values of 146, 242, 105 and HSL of 102°, 84%, 68%. This highly saturated hue evokes energy and excitement, making it suitable for popular for illustrations and friendly visual themes.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.
The complementary color of #92F269 is #C969F2,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#D7F269.
